The problem with the Lightnings' is that none of them are stock. You can spend $500 on a supercharger pulley and a chip with a new serpentine belt and add 80rwhp. My lightning ran 12.77 in the 1/4 mile with this mod. It ran a 13.2-13.5 stock. But like I said, it is so easy to mod them, nobody leaves them stock...
